Cemvita Inc. Company Profile
Background
Overview
Cemvita Inc., founded in 2017 and headquartered in Houston, Texas, is a regenerative biotechnology company dedicated to transforming carbon waste into valuable resources. By leveraging synthetic biology, Cemvita aims to revolutionize heavy industries through sustainable and scalable solutions.

Financials and Funding
Funding History
- Series A Funding: In August 2021, Cemvita announced the initial closing of its Series A financing round, led by 8090 Partners, with participation from Oxy Low Carbon Ventures (OLCV), Seldor Capital, and Climate Capital.
- Strategic Investments: In October 2021, Sumitomo Corporation of Americas (SCOA) participated in a Series A funding round to support Cemvita's decarbonization efforts.

Pipeline Development
Key Pipeline Candidates
- Sustainable Aviation Fuel (SAF): Cemvita has developed a process to convert CO₂ into SAF, addressing the aviation industry's need for sustainable fuel alternatives.
- Bio-Based Chemicals: The company is working on producing various bio-based chemicals and polymers through its synthetic biology platform.
Stages of Development
- Pilot Plant Operations: Cemvita operates a 55,000-liter capacity pilot plant in Houston, producing microbial oil as a feedstock for SAF and other bio-based products.
- Commercialization Efforts: The company is in the process of scaling up its technologies for full commercial deployment, including plans for a commercial demonstration plant.

Strategic Collaborations and Partnerships
- United Airlines: In September 2023, United Airlines signed an agreement to purchase up to 1 billion gallons of SAF from Cemvita over 20 years, with an annual supply of up to 50 million gallons.
